Duties include, but are not limited to:

a. Schedules exams in a manner to optimize scanner times while maintaining flexibility for emergency cases. This requires the ability to prioritize scheduled patients as well as the ability to accommodate the emergency patient who may need immediate emergency surgery, etc.
b. Confers with radiologists to determine requirement of non-standard exams. Determines technical factors, positioning, number, and thickness of scans, etc., to produce and satisfy requirements of CT scanning. Assists with scheduling add-on patients for examinations. Advises radiologists or referring physicians of examination results. Notifies them of scans requiring their immediate attention.
c. Performs all procedures relative to all general C.T. exams and more complex exams such as CTA coronary, abdominal and neuro, exams.
d. IR procedures CT tech will identify area of interest, places grid on patient, and scan to demonstrate for radiologist proper location for needle insertion. Will continue to scan when needed with continuous observation of CT dose optimization. Send all images and case exam efficiently.
e. Prepares contrast materials that are used in CT. Improper use or administration of the contrast materials run the risk of patient mortality and, therefore, it is essential that a thorough understanding of the contrast material usage is possessed by those who prepare it. In addition, must be continuously on the alert to the patient's condition and other disorders. Reactions on the part of the patient require immediate attention so that harm does not come to the patient. Is certified to insert IV needles for administration of contrast material when necessary.
f. Practices radiation safety to reduce exposure to patients, staff, and self. This is achieved using lead aprons, lead gloves, lead shields, lead lined walls and collimation. Film badges are worn by the technologists in compliance with radiation regulations.
g. Performs reconstructions of CT and angiographic studies when requested or when part of a standard procedure. Along with reprocessing data on 3D workstation. I.E. MIP's, Volume
h. Maintains CT schedule to notify staff when patient needs labs, allergic to contrast, when patient is here, which patient will need oral contrast, and any add-on CTs. Maintains workflow of new orders for protocoling under policy 23.
i. Properly identifies patient images. This is essential so that mistaken identity of patient images does not occur. The technologist must be certain that the patient identifiers and the request are identical. Confirms patient identity by verbally confirming patient's full name and date of birth.
j. Responsible to explain exams to competent patients so that patients understand what is to be done as well as what hazards, if any, are possible, and have informed consent ready for known allergic reaction &/or less than standard labs for contrast procedures.
k. Responsible for stocking and inventory of all CT supplies and related materials.
I. Performs irregular hour emergency scans on standby, 24hours per day, coverage. Requires the technologist be available within 30 minutes from receipt of call so that proper and effective emergency care can be given to the patient. May be required to perform diagnostic radiographic examinations.
m. Continually reviews new developments in the field of computerized tomography. Is continually on the alert to improve quality of exams utilizing the new technologies available. The purpose of this review is to provide the patients with the best possible scans for diagnostic purposes.
n. Notifies proper personnel when there is a disrupt with the daily schedule due to CT room down for proper cleaning, equipment failure, etc.
